ABCIN: Emir Of Yamaltu Blesses Gombe Candidates Vying For National Offices

Posted on July 27, 2024July 27, 2024 by Jtimes

By Yunusa Isa, Gombe

The Emir of Yamaltu, His Royal Highness Alhaji Abubakar Aliyu Hinna, has blessed the Gombe State candidates contesting for national vice chairman and national public relations offices of the Association of Badminton Clubs in Nigeria (ABCIN) in its forthcoming 2024 general elections.

Abubakar Aliyu who is the Grand Patron Gombe Badminton Club, showered the blessings when the club members paid him a courtesy visit at his palace.

Admonishing the contestants; Esther Daniel vying for the national vice chairman seat and Yusuf Sarki vying for the national P.R.O., the royal father charged them to play politics with decorum.

“Do not take this as a do or die affair, if you lost, accept it in good faith, and try your luck the next time, may be your time is not now, the best for you is ahead. But if you win, thank God and put in your best to move our association forward, learn from the successes of the current leadership and build on. On their mistakes, make corrections, for they are lessons to you”.

He expressed confidence in the two candidates, maintaining that they are equal to the tasks.

While praying for God Almighty to grant them success, the emir assured the contestants of his full support, maintaining that his doors are always open to chip-in at all points.

Alhaji Abubakar Aliyu Hinna is a Royal Father to Nigeria Badminton Family, Member Board of Trustees ABCIN, and former Board Member Badminton Federation of Nigeria (North East).

Presenting the candidates to the grand patron, the chairman Gombe State Badminton Club Alhaji Yahaya Umar Umaru, represented by the club captain Engineer Hayatuddeen Usman, said they were at the palace to present to him the candidates, seek for his advice and have his blessings on the mission.

In his vote of thanks on behalf of the team, the candidate for the national public relations office of the ABCIN Yusuf Sarki, appreciated the royal father for the warm reception and audience, assuring to put the advice of the emir into use.

Sarki said they decided to join the race to contribute their quota in the development of Badminton in Nigeria.

He said Badminton history can not be complete in the country without the name of the royal father, considering his roles and contributions to the game in Nigeria.
